Stroking 86 250R with 89 crank
#1
I have a 86 TRX 250r and want to put a 87-89 crank in it because it has a 5 mm longer stroke. I am getting sick of having my budy with and 89 get out of the whole quicker. Can I use my cylinder or do I need to change out the top end?

#3
If you use a 87-89 crank. Build a spacer plate motor. Get the plate & studs from Nacs racing around $60.00 and use the 86 piston. The money you save on the 87 crank will buy the spacer kit.
